Key Industries and Employers

Rockford's economy is diverse, with several key industries driving employment. Healthcare, manufacturing, education, and retail are among the top sectors providing numerous job opportunities. Let's delve deeper into each:

  • Healthcare: The healthcare sector is a major employer in Rockford, with hospitals, clinics, and healthcare facilities constantly seeking talented professionals. Major healthcare providers like OSF HealthCare and Mercyhealth are always on the lookout for nurses, medical assistants, technicians, and administrative staff. This sector offers a wide array of positions, from entry-level roles to specialized medical professions. The demand for healthcare professionals is consistently high, making it a stable and rewarding career path.
  • Manufacturing: Rockford has a rich manufacturing history, and this sector remains a significant contributor to the local economy. Manufacturing companies in Rockford produce a variety of goods, including aerospace components, industrial machinery, and automotive parts. If you're skilled in areas like machining, engineering, or production management, you'll find ample opportunities here. Companies like Woodward, Inc., and Collins Aerospace have a strong presence in the region, offering competitive salaries and benefits. The manufacturing sector is evolving with the adoption of new technologies, making it an exciting field for those with technical skills and a desire to innovate.
  • Education: The education sector is another pillar of Rockford's economy, providing jobs in both public and private institutions. From teachers and administrators to support staff and researchers, there are numerous roles available in this field. Rockford Public School District 205 is one of the largest employers in the region, offering a variety of positions for educators and support personnel. Higher education institutions like Rockford University and Rock Valley College also contribute significantly to the job market. The education sector offers a fulfilling career path for those passionate about shaping the future generation and contributing to community development.
  • Retail: The retail sector in Rockford provides a significant number of entry-level and customer service positions. Retail stores, restaurants, and hospitality businesses are always seeking enthusiastic individuals to join their teams. Whether you're interested in sales, customer service, or management, the retail sector offers a diverse range of opportunities. Major retail centers like CherryVale Mall and the various shopping districts throughout the city provide a hub of activity and employment. The retail sector is a great starting point for those looking to build their customer service skills and advance their careers in management or other related fields.

Top Companies Hiring in Rockford

Knowing the top companies that are hiring in Rockford can significantly narrow down your job search. These companies often offer competitive salaries, benefits, and opportunities for career growth. Here's a list of some major employers in the area:

  1. OSF HealthCare: As one of the largest healthcare providers in the region, OSF HealthCare frequently has job openings for various medical and administrative positions. They offer a wide range of career opportunities, from nursing and medical technology to management and support roles. OSF HealthCare is committed to providing quality healthcare services and offers a supportive work environment for its employees. They also invest in employee development and training, making it a great place to advance your career in healthcare.
  2. Mercyhealth: Another leading healthcare system in Rockford, Mercyhealth, is consistently hiring healthcare professionals. They have multiple locations and specialties, providing a diverse range of job options. Mercyhealth is known for its patient-centered care and commitment to community health. They offer competitive benefits packages and opportunities for professional growth. Whether you're a physician, nurse, technician, or administrative professional, Mercyhealth provides a rewarding career path in the healthcare sector.
  3. Woodward, Inc.: This global company manufactures control systems and components for the aerospace and industrial markets. Woodward, Inc., offers opportunities in engineering, manufacturing, and administration. They have a strong presence in Rockford and are known for their innovative products and solutions. Woodward, Inc., values employee development and provides opportunities for training and advancement. They also offer competitive compensation and benefits packages, making it an attractive employer in the manufacturing sector.
  4. Collins Aerospace: A division of Raytheon Technologies, Collins Aerospace is a major player in the aerospace industry. Their Rockford facility focuses on the design and manufacturing of aircraft systems and components. They hire engineers, technicians, and other professionals with technical expertise. Collins Aerospace is a global leader in aerospace technology and offers employees the chance to work on cutting-edge projects. They also provide opportunities for international assignments and career development, making it a great place for those seeking a challenging and rewarding career in aerospace.
  5. Rockford Public School District 205: As one of the largest employers in the region, the school district offers numerous jobs in education and support services. They hire teachers, administrators, and support staff for schools throughout the city. Rockford Public School District 205 is committed to providing quality education to students and offers a supportive work environment for its employees. They also offer professional development opportunities and competitive benefits packages, making it a great place to work for those passionate about education.

Networking and Professional Connections

Networking is a powerful tool in your job search arsenal. Attend industry events, job fairs, and professional meetups to connect with people in your field. Informational interviews can also be incredibly helpful—reach out to people working in roles or companies that interest you and ask for a brief chat to learn more about their experiences. Building and maintaining professional relationships can open doors to job opportunities that you might not find through online job boards. LinkedIn is an excellent platform for networking, allowing you to connect with professionals in your industry and join relevant groups. Remember, networking is about building relationships, so be genuine and focus on creating meaningful connections.

Tailoring Your Resume and Cover Letter

A generic resume and cover letter won't cut it in today's competitive job market. Tailor your resume and cover letter to each specific job you apply for, highlighting the skills and experiences that are most relevant to the position. Use keywords from the job description and quantify your accomplishments whenever possible. A well-crafted resume and cover letter will capture the attention of hiring managers and increase your chances of landing an interview. Be sure to proofread your documents carefully for any errors in grammar or spelling. Seek feedback from friends, family, or career counselors to ensure your resume and cover letter are polished and professional.
